Transaction 83420d41526553242e495491b43344ce18a35d42d66832670f21cfb63a9ec7cd
1 Input
1 Output
-
83420d41526553242e495491b43344ce18a35d42d66832670f21cfb63a9ec7cd:0
- value
- 6487176
- script pubkey
- OP_0 OP_PUSHBYTES_20 04bcf06aba4206e7a0b3bd1d32bc5236072f6551
- address
- bc1qqj70q646ggrw0g9nh5wn90zjxcrj7e23led3g3